MySQL数据库的基本操作

介绍

MySQL是一个广受欢迎的开源关系型数据库管理系统,它支持广泛的应用程序。在MySQL中,我们可以创建数据库来存储和管理数据。本文将介绍如何在MySQL中创建数据库,并提供一些常用的数据库操作示例。

准备工作

在开始之前,您需要先安装并配置好MySQL数据库。您可以从MySQL官方网站上下载并安装MySQL,然后根据官方文档进行配置。

创建数据库

在MySQL中,我们可以使用CREATE DATABASE语句来创建数据库。下面是一个示例:

CREATE DATABASE mydatabase;

在上面的示例中,我们创建了一个名为mydatabase的数据库。您可以根据需要为数据库指定任何名称。请注意,数据库名称是区分大小写的。

使用数据库

一旦我们创建了数据库,我们就可以使用USE语句来切换到该数据库。下面是一个示例:

USE mydatabase;

在上面的示例中,我们使用USE语句将当前数据库切换为mydatabase。之后的所有操作都将在该数据库中执行。

创建表

数据库是用来存储和管理数据的。在MySQL中,我们使用表来组织和存储数据。下面是一个示例,展示了如何创建一个名为users的表:

CREATE TABLE users (
  id INT AUTO_INCREMENT PRIMARY KEY,
  name VARCHAR(50),
  age INT
);

在上面的示例中,我们创建了一个名为users的表,该表包含了id、name和age三个列。id列是主键,用于唯一标识每一行数据;name列是一个长度为50的字符串;age列是一个整数。

插入数据

一旦我们创建了表,我们就可以使用INSERT INTO语句向表中插入数据。下面是一个示例:

INSERT INTO users (name, age) VALUES ('Alice', 25);
INSERT INTO users (name, age) VALUES ('Bob', 30);

在上面的示例中,我们向users表中插入了两行数据。第一行数据的name列为'Alice',age列为25;第二行数据的name列为'Bob',age列为30。

查询数据

在MySQL中,我们使用SELECT语句来查询数据。下面是一个示例:

SELECT * FROM users;

在上面的示例中,我们查询了users表中的所有数据。使用*表示选择所有列。

更新数据

如果我们需要更新表中的数据,可以使用UPDATE语句。下面是一个示例:

UPDATE users SET age = 26 WHERE name = 'Alice';

在上面的示例中,我们将users表中name列为'Alice'的行的age列更新为26。

删除数据

如果我们需要删除表中的数据,可以使用DELETE FROM语句。下面是一个示例:

DELETE FROM users WHERE name = 'Bob';

在上面的示例中,我们删除了users表中name列为'Bob'的行。

总结

MySQL是一个功能强大的关系型数据库管理系统,它提供了许多用于创建、管理和查询数据库的功能。在本文中,我们介绍了如何在MySQL中创建数据库,并进行了一些常用的数据库操作示例。希望这些示例可以帮助您更好地理解和使用MySQL数据库。

旅行图

journey
  title MySQL数据库的基本操作
  section 准备工作
    安装并配置MySQL数据库
  section 创建数据库
    创建一个名为mydatabase的数据库
  section 使用数据库
    切换到mydatabase数据库
  section 创建表
    创建一个名为users的表
  section 插入数据
    向users表中插入数据
  section 查询数据
    查询users表中的所有数据
  section 更新数据
    更新users表中的数据
  section 删除数据
    删除users表中的数据

状态图

stateDiagram
  [*] --> 准备工作
  准备工作 --> 创建数据库
  创建数据库 --> 使用数据库
  使用数据库 --> 创建表
  创建表 --> 插入数据